How Common Is The Last Name Herer? popularity and diffusion
The surname Herer is the 1,140,742nd most prevalent last name worldwide, held by approximately 1 in 34,538,132 people. This last name occ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 56 percent of Herer reside; 56 percent reside in North America and 52 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
The surname Herer is most frequently occurring in The United States, where it is borne by 108 people, or 1 in 3,356,101. In The United States Herer is mostly found in: Massachusetts, where 19 percent reside, New York, where 16 percent reside and California, where 12 percent reside. Not including The United States it is found in 20 countries. It is also found in Germany, where 12 percent reside and France, where 9 percent reside.
Herer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Herer has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 432 percent between 1880 and 2014.
